I was initially contacted via LinkedIn after I had been referred to the hiring manager. The email simply asked if I would consider leaving my current employer. I responded with a typical, "I'd consider it if the opportunity was right" response.
I met informally with the owners during lunch one day and they more or less wanted to make sure I was capable of performing what they required. They asked general questions about the online marketing & advertising industry to make sure I knew what I was talking about. Before leaving I made several suggestions to improve their current model and they seemed impressed.
A few days after our initial meeting, I received a phone call from the owners and an offer letter via email.
